The Shining, an opera by composer Paul Moravec and librettist Mark Campbell, is based on Stephen King’s bestselling novel and tells the story of Jack Torrance’s descent into madness at the secluded Overlook Hotel, famously inspired by Colorado’s own Stanley Hotel in Estes Park. The opera had its world premiere in 2016, and Opera Colorado will be the second to present it in February and March, 2022, at the Ellie Caulkins Opera House in Denver.
